Insights
Reoperation after coronary artery bypass grafting carries significant risks. Coronary angioplasty presents a safer alternative treatment for terminal coronary artery disease, with lower morbidity and acceptable mortality rates.
Area of Science:
- Cardiovascular Surgery
- Interventional Cardiology
Background:
- Coronary artery bypass grafting (CABG) is a common treatment for coronary artery disease.
- Reoperation after CABG is associated with substantial risks, including increased morbidity and mortality.
- Terminal coronary artery disease presents unique challenges for treatment.
Observation:
- Advances in percutaneous coronary intervention (PCI), commonly known as coronary angioplasty, offer a less invasive treatment option.
- Coronary angioplasty has demonstrated potential for managing complex coronary artery disease.
- Evaluating the risks and benefits of angioplasty versus reoperation is crucial for patient outcomes.
Findings:
- Coronary angioplasty provides an alternative treatment strategy for patients with terminal coronary artery disease.
- This approach is associated with significantly lower morbidity compared to reoperation after CABG.
- Mortality rates for coronary angioplasty in this patient group are acceptable and comparable to conservative management.
Implications:
- Coronary angioplasty may be a preferred revascularization strategy for select patients with end-stage coronary artery disease.
- This shift in treatment paradigm can improve patient quality of life and reduce healthcare costs associated with repeat surgeries.
- Further research should focus on long-term outcomes and patient selection criteria for angioplasty in complex coronary artery disease.
